Objective of course
Students are able to work in the polytechnic learning and operational environment. They are aware of the structure of the degree program, their future profession and the polytechnic studies as part of the European higher education system. Students become familiar with their student group and understand how to promote positive learning environment. They are capable of utilizing the support services of studies.
